Lady Day at Emerson’s Bar & Grill recounts Billie Holiday’s life story through her poignant voice and moving songs. The time is 1959. The place is a seedy bar in Philadelphia. The audience is about to witness of the greatest jazz singers of all-time, as she shares her loves and her losses, in a final performance, four months before her death. Among the songs that will be performed: “God Bless the Child,” “What a Little Moonlight Can Do,” “Strange Fruit” and “Taint Nobody’s Biz-ness.”

 

Lady Day herself, will be portrayed by Wilmington Songstress LaRaisha DiEvelyn Burnette and the production is directed by Thalian Association Community Theatre’s Artistic Director, David T. Loudermilk. This exciting show is our third production in Duplin County and part of our outreach program to bring community theatre to all residents in southeastern North Carolina.
